Common questions

How do I apply for eThekwini Municipality tenders?
Find the tender here, open the official document from the source link, and submit your bid through the national eTenders portal or eThekwini Municipality's own procurement channel before the closing date. You'll need an active CSD (Central Supplier Database) registration to bid. VUZA shows you what's open and points you to the source. It isn't where you submit.
